What are Progressive Web Apps?
A progressive web application is like a native mobile app but is developed using web app development technologies, i.e., CSS, JavaScript, and HTML. The PWAs are intended to work on any device and platform that has a standard web browser, considering both mobile and desktop devices.
Progressive web applications bridge the gap between native mobile apps and web applications. Since PWA is ultimately a web application, it doesn’t require distinct distribution or bundling. Furthermore, developers are not restricted to setting up web applications through digital distribution platforms like Google Play or Apple App Store.

Features of a PWA:
The major benefit of PWA over native-mobile applications is that they are intended to work on any device or browser as they are built with proper web standards. As with many cross-platform resolutions, the aim is to aid developers in developing cross-platform apps more effortlessly than they would with native applications. Here are the major features of a PWA:
a. Receptive:
PWAs are suitable for any form factor – mobile, desktop, or tablet.
b. Advanced:
These apps can work for all users, irrespective of the browser, utilizing advanced technologies.
c. Easy Connectivity:
PWAs are built using service workers, which allows accessibility of data on low-quality networks or offline usages.
d. Cache storage makes PWA faster:
After the preliminary loading gets completed, the same page elements aren’t required to load again and again.
e. Updated:
It is always up-to-date as it works on the web, unlike the native mobile app, which requires updating manually.
f. Native-feel:
The users get the experience of a native mobile application.
g. Re-engagement factor:
You can send push notifications to users through a PWA to preserve engagement
h. Safe & Secure:
PWAs are served via HTTP to avert interference and guarantee that the content has not been meddled with.
i. Linkable:
PWAs can be shared through URL easily and don’t require any difficult installation.
j. Easy to install:
It provides home screen icons without the usage of an app store.
k. Cost-Effective:
You can save money as the mobile app development cost is generally much higher than the PWA app development cost.

Why Should You Invest in PWA Development?
Here are some interesting statistics that show the power of PWA and answer your question:
1. The Starbucks PWA has increased daily active users 2x. Orders on the desktop are at nearly the same rate as on mobile.
2. Streaming Platform ZEE5 launched its PWA to expand its reach. The PWA is 3x faster and reduces buffering time by 50%.
3. Kubota launched their e-commerce PWA, which resulted in a 192% growth in daily visitors and a 26% growth in average monthly visits.
4. After launching its PWA, Thomas Kent lowered its bounce rate by 57% and increased the revenue from organic traffic by 79%.

1. Ionic Framework:
In 2013, the Drifty Co. created the Ionic framework, and by 2015, Ionic developers had created over 1.3 million applications using this SDK. Ionic is an absolute open-source framework for progressive web application development. It provides all the required tools and services for the development of hybrid mobile apps using technologies like CSS, HTML5, and Sass.
What makes Ionic the best framework for progressive web apps is its usage of technology by service workers. The service workers power the offline functionality, push notifications, background content updating, content caching, and more.
Ionic app developers work with over 120 native device features such as HealthKit, Fingerprint Authorization, and Bluetooth, along with Cordova plugins and typescript extensions; it allows mobile app developers the utmost ease of developing advanced mobile apps.

2. Polymer:
Built by Google, Polymer is an open-source PWA framework with an extensive variety of web components, templates, and development tools. It empowers mobile app developers to create custom HTML elements known as web components. These reusable code components can be seamlessly integrated into Progressive Web Apps, enhancing their functionality and user experience.
The modular architecture of Polymer and its optimized components help create lightweight and efficient progressive web apps. Thus, the resultant load time is quite less, resulting in a better user experience.
Polymer also ensures that the developed PWAs are always compatible with a range of browsers. Thus, the users will get a consistent user experience across different devices and platforms. It is best suited for projects that require modularity and adherence to web standards.

4. Vue.js:
Vue is a popular open-source framework with a robust platform for developing high-performance Progressive Web Apps (PWAs). It offers high versatility and flexibility to suit various web development projects, from simple applications to complex enterprise solutions.
It also utilizes a virtual DOM, which improves the rendering efficiency and contributes to creating scalable and responsive PWAs. Vue.js also integrates easily with browser downloads and server-side rendering, making it a popular choice among PWA developers.
Additionally, Vue.js supports a component-based architecture by which the PWA developers can divide intricate user interfaces into smaller, reusable parts. Apart from improving code maintainability, this modular approach is in complex harmony with PWA principles, which allow components to be streamlined and reused across different application areas.

6. Magento PWA Studio:
Offered by Adobe, Magento PWA Studio offers various tools for PWA developers to create, deploy, and maintain a PWA storefront on Magento 2.3 and later Magento versions. Online merchants can quickly and cost-effectively launch the mobile storefront of their e-commerce store.
The Magento PWA Studio utilizes modern libraries and tools to develop a framework aligned with Magento’s extensibility principles. It provides ready-to-use PWA solutions for web development, ensuring smooth operation without code conflicts.
If you already have an e-commerce store in Magento, then this is the best framework that we recommend for creating a PWA version of your online store. It offers a very streamlined integration into Magento.

9. Preact:
The Preact framework is similar to the React framework but smaller and faster. The PWA framework is easy to use, which makes it a first choice for developers who are new to web development. It provides the thinnest possible Virtual DOM abstraction on top of the DOM. It builds on stable platform features, registers real event handlers, and plays nicely with other libraries.
